New Run Timing System

What’s Been Developed We will be providing personal print outs for

every runner on the day. Making it easier to find your time. Come visit us a few minutes after you’ve finished and return your timing chip and collect your time.

More Information online about your run

You’ll find on our new website more information about your run than before. Covering average pace, split times for 10k and half marathon runners alongside the usual category position.

You can see your results on Sunday 18th after the race by 3.00PMwww.pbeventtiming.co.uk/results

Additional timing mats

New timing matts have given us the ability to provide all 10k and half marathon runners a lap time. They are also much wider eliminating any chance that your time won’t be recorded. Just make sure you cross over the matts on the course – don’t worry you can’t miss them.

New Timing Chips

We will be handing out timing chips at Sign In on the day. We will be using lightweight timing chips that fasten onto your shoe laces. Don’t have laces? This won’t be an issue as we will have plenty of twist ties that can fasten the timing chips.

Page 3: runatstanwicklakes.files.wordpress.com  · Web view2018-03-14 · We will be providing personal print outs for every runner on the day. Making it easier to find your time. Come visit

Timing Mats There are two blue mats on the course both around the start/finish line. It is essential to cross these mats when running the course otherwise your time will not be recorded. Do not try and jump over or run around them just continue over the mats as normal. The mats will register your timing chip which should be fastened onto your shoe.

The timing team will be at registration to answer any questions you may have as well as assist you on correctly fitting your timing chip.
